MUSCAT: Indian School Al Seeb (ISAS) is all set to host Avenir 2025, the flagship Educational and Career
Guidance Programme under the aegis of the Board of Directors, Indian Schools in the Sultanate
of Oman.

Scheduled from 25th to 27th October 2025, this much-anticipated three-day event aims
to equip students with knowledge, skills, and inspiration to navigate the dynamic landscape of
career and higher education opportunities.


With the central theme “Empowering to Lead”, Avenir 2025 will bring together students,
educators, alumni, universities, entrepreneurs, and industry leaders under one roof for a
transformative educational experience.


The Board of Directors, Indian Schools Oman, provides equal opportunities for all the students
of Indian Schools across Oman to understand and discern their future course of studies and
careers by conducting Avenir every year.

Mr. Syed Salman, Chairman of the Indian School Board, has verily expressed this and said, “Avenir 2025 is more than a career fair; it’s a catalyst for shaping future-ready students by combining inspiration with information. Through active participation, collaboration, and engagement, we aim to prepare students to lead with purpose in a fast-changing world.”

Key Highlights of Avenir 2025

  • Motivational Talk by Master Raul John Aju – Founder, AIREALM Technologies
    A visionary educator who has taught over 150,000 students and delivered 1,000+ sessions
    worldwide. He is a 3x TEDx speaker and has been invited 3x by Google, cementing his role as a
    young voice shaping the future of technology.
  • Career Awareness Sessions: Aimed at providing students with a deeper understanding of
    diverse career paths, the sessions will feature insights from accomplished alumni across Indian
    schools in Oman. Schools have been invited to nominate distinguished alumni to guide and
    inspire students.
  • Visionera – The Young Entrepreneurs’ Forum: In a unique initiative to foster innovation and
    enterprise, ISAS will host Visionera, a student-led start-up exhibition. Schools will showcase
    original entrepreneurial ideas, encouraging the spirit of creativity, leadership, and problem-
    solving among youth.
  • Indian School Influencers: Adding a fresh perspective, student speakers from various Indian
    schools will deliver short yet powerful influential talks, highlighting real stories of passion,
    perseverance, and purpose.
  • Industry Panel Discussion: CEOs and corporate leaders will engage in a high-level panel on
    “The Importance of Soft Skills in Building a Career”, addressing the evolving needs of the
    workforce.
  • Career Counselling and University Interaction: This dynamic outreach programme will
    bring together representatives from reputed universities in Oman, giving students and parents
    direct access to information about higher education, admissions, and scholarships.
  • Peer Career Counselling: Certified counsellors from participating schools will offer intensive
    guidance to students, ensuring personalized support irrespective of institutional affiliation.
